                        That would be good news, though it doesn't solve the bigger problem of putting these games on "ASN" in the first place. Hockey East gets NBCSN, NCHC gets CBS Sports Network, Big 10 has their own network. Even the WCHA has FS North, which I assume can be shared with other FOX Sports affiliates depending on who's playing ... and we get syndicated networks that may or may not even be in HD, much less may or may not be available on our cable providers. For the best league in the country. It's asinine.
